What Is Laser Tattoo Removal?

Laser tattoo removal is a cosmetic procedure that uses concentrated light energy to break down tattoo ink particles beneath the skin. The body’s immune system then gradually clears these fragmented ink particles over time, resulting in the fading or complete disappearance of the tattoo.

How Does Laser Tattoo Removal Work?

The laser emits specific wavelengths of light that target different ink colors without damaging the surrounding skin. Multiple sessions are usually required because the ink particles must be broken down gradually. The laser’s pulse breaks the ink into tiny pieces small enough for your body’s natural processes to remove.

Who Is a Good Candidate for Laser Tattoo Removal?

Most people looking to remove unwanted tattoos are suitable candidates. Ideal clients have healthy skin without infections or skin conditions in the treatment area. Laser tattoo removal can work on most ink colors, but results vary depending on ink age, colors, and depth.

What to Expect During the Laser Tattoo Removal Sessions?

Each session typically lasts between 10 to 30 minutes, depending on tattoo size and laser type. You might feel a sensation similar to rubber band snaps on the skin, which varies by individual tolerance. Protective eyewear is worn to safeguard your eyes during treatment.

How Many Laser Sessions Are Required?

The number of sessions depends on several factors, including the tattoo’s size, ink color, depth, and your skin’s response to treatment. Generally, 6 to 10 sessions spaced 6 to 8 weeks apart are common for most tattoos. Patience is key to achieving desired results.

How to Prepare for Your Laser Tattoo Removal Treatment

Before your appointment, avoid sun exposure to reduce skin sensitivity. Keep the tattoo clean and hydrated but avoid applying lotions or other products right before treatment. Discuss your medical history and any skin concerns with your provider.

Aftercare for Laser Tattoo Removal

Proper aftercare accelerates healing and reduces side effects. Expect redness, swelling, or mild scabbing which usually subsides within days. Avoid direct sun exposure and use recommended ointments. Follow your practitioner’s instructions carefully to support skin recovery.

Potential Side Effects and Risks

Though generally safe, laser tattoo removal may cause temporary side effects including redness, blistering, or changes in skin pigmentation. These effects usually resolve with proper care. Choosing experienced professionals minimizes risk.

Common Misconceptions About Laser Tattoo Removal

Some people think laser removal is too painful or leaves scars, but advancements have made treatments more comfortable and safer. Also, not all tattoos fade completely—some colors or older tattoos might need additional sessions or complementary treatments.

FAQs

What does Laser Tattoo Removal feel like?

Most clients describe the sensation as rubber band snaps against the skin. Topical numbing creams may be applied to ease discomfort.

Can all tattoo colors be removed?

Most ink colors respond well, but some, like green and blue, may take longer to fade or require specialized lasers.

How long does each session last?

Sessions typically last 10 to 30 minutes, depending on the tattoo size and laser settings.

Is laser tattoo removal safe for all skin types?

Yes, modern lasers can safely treat different skin tones, but consultation is crucial to tailor treatment.

How soon can I see results after treatment?

Some fading appears after the first session, but full results take multiple sessions with healing time between them.

What should I avoid after laser tattoo removal?

Avoid sun exposure, swimming, and heavy exfoliation until your skin fully heals to prevent complications.
